1992 Morgan 4 vs. 2005 Morgan Roadster

To start off, 2005 Morgan Roadster is newer by 13 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Morgan 4.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Morgan 4 would be higher. At 2,967 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Morgan Roadster is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Morgan Roadster (224 HP @ 6100 RPM) has 119 more horse power than 1992 Morgan 4. (105 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Morgan Roadster should accelerate faster than 1992 Morgan 4.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Morgan Roadster weights approximately 75 kg more than 1992 Morgan 4.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Morgan Roadster (285 Nm @ 4900 RPM) has 150 more torque (in Nm) than 1992 Morgan 4. (135 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 2005 Morgan Roadster will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1992 Morgan 4.

Compare all specifications:

1992 Morgan 4 2005 Morgan Roadster
Make Morgan Morgan
Model 4 Roadster
Year Released 1992 2005
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1598 cc 2967 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Horse Power 105 HP 224 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 6100 RPM
Torque 135 Nm 285 Nm
Torque RPM 2800 RPM 4900 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 2 seats
Vehicle Weight 865 kg 940 kg
Vehicle Length 4020 mm 4020 mm
Vehicle Width 1510 mm 1730 mm
Vehicle Height 1320 mm 1230 mm
Wheelbase Size 2450 mm 2500 mm
